
juc并发包使用
llsses
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
JUC并发包——Lock锁解决生产者消费者问题
原来的写法 package com.bjsxt.commu1; import java.util.ArrayList; import java.util.List;/** * 商品工厂 */public class ProductFactory { private List<String> list = new ArrayList&l...原创 2019-06-21 11:56:38 · 304 阅读 · 0 评论 -
JUC并发包——BlockingQueue 阻塞队列 解决生产者消费者问题
测试类不做任何修改 package com.bjsxt.commu2; import com.bjsxt.commu1.ProductFactory2; public class Test3 { public static void main(String[] args) { //创建并启动多个生产者和消费者线程 fi...原创 2019-06-22 20:49:43 · 365 阅读 · 0 评论 -
JUC并发包——ForkJoin框架简单了解
一、ForkJoin框架 Fork/Join 分叉/结合框架。 1. 什么是ForkJoin框架适用场景虽然目前处理器核心数已经发展到很大数目,但是按任务并发处理并不能完全充分的利用处理器资源,因为一般的应用程序没有那么多的并发处理任务。基于这种现状,考虑把一个任务拆分成多个单元,每个单元分别得到执行,最后合并每个单元的结果。Fork/Joi...原创 2019-06-30 23:36:59 · 303 阅读 · 0 评论